1. Setup

1.1 Unboxing and Initial Preparation

Upon unboxing, ensure all packing materials, including zip ties and protective screws, are removed from the printer. The printer is designed for quick setup, allowing you to start printing in approximately 10 minutes.

1.2 Filament Loading

Attach the filament spool holder to the rear of the printer. Guide the filament from the spool into the filament runout sensor and then into the extruder. The intelligent Hall filament runout sensor and tangle detection system will monitor the filament during printing.

1.4 Network Setup

Connect your printer to your Wi-Fi network via the touchscreen interface. This enables remote control, monitoring, and file transfer through the Klipper-based system and the QIDI mobile application.

2.2 Printing Process

Load your desired G-code file from local storage or a USB drive. The printer supports various materials including PLA, PETG, TPU, ABS, ASA, PA, PC, Carbon Fiber, and Glass Fiber filaments, with a bimetal nozzle supporting up to 350°C.

2.3 Monitoring and Remote Control

The built-in 1080P HD camera allows real-time monitoring and time-lapse photography of your prints. Remote control is available via the mobile application, enabling you to manage prints from anywhere.

3.3 Optional Activated Carbon Air Filter

An optional activated carbon air filter can be installed to reduce dust and fumes, especially when printing with materials that may emit fine particles. The design for the filter box can be downloaded from the official wiki.

5. Specifications

FeatureDetail
Product Dimensions18.39 x 18.78 x 19.25 inches
Item Weight45 pounds
Model NumberAU-Q1Pro
BrandR QIDI TECHNOLOGY
MaterialABS and metal
Max Print Speed600mm/s
Max Nozzle Temp350°C
Max Chamber Temp60°C
FirmwareKlipper
Camera1080P HD
